The Jospong Group, a leading conglomerate with over 60 subsidiaries operating across diverse sectors, has embarked on a strategic expansion into Kenya, marking a significant step in its broader Africa Expansion Project. This initiative, spearheaded by Executive Chairman Dr. Joseph Siaw Agyepong, aims to transform Africa’s sanitation challenges into opportunities for economic growth and development. The Group’s entry into Kenya, specifically Mombasa County, is not merely about business expansion; it represents a commitment to sharing expertise, building local capacity, and fostering African-led development. The Jospong Group envisions a future where waste management is not a burden but a driver of economic progress and environmental sustainability.

The cornerstone of this venture is a collaborative partnership between the Jospong Group and the Mombasa County government, led by Governor Abdullswamad Sherrif Nassir. High-level discussions between Dr. Agyepong and Governor Nassir have focused on implementing innovative and sustainable waste management solutions tailored to Mombasa’s specific needs. The partnership aims to address pressing sanitation challenges while simultaneously creating economic opportunities for local communities. This aligns with the Jospong Group’s overarching mission of championing African excellence through inclusive and sustainable business models. The collaborative approach underscores the importance of local ownership and partnership in achieving impactful and lasting solutions.

Dr. Agyepong emphasizes the critical role of African business leaders in driving the continent’s economic independence. He argues that economic liberation is not solely the responsibility of politicians, but rather a mandate for entrepreneurs and business leaders to invest, trade, and break down the barriers that hinder intra-African movement and collaboration. He draws a parallel to the struggle for political independence, asserting that it is now the responsibility of the business community to lead the charge for economic self-reliance. This, he believes, can be achieved through entrepreneurship, strategic investments, and increased trade within the continent.

Central to Dr. Agyepong’s vision is leveraging Africa’s vast resources and potential. He calls for a united front among African businesses to harness the continent’s size, abundant natural resources, large labor force, and favorable climate to protect Africa from exploitation. He advocates for regional integration through enhanced coordination and cooperation, fostering intra-African trade and investment. This, he emphasizes, must be spearheaded by the private sector, with businesses driving economic diplomacy and transformation. The focus is on developing innovative solutions to pressing continental challenges, including waste management and climate change, showcasing African ingenuity and leadership.

Furthermore, Dr. Agyepong stresses the importance of dismantling barriers to cross-border collaboration. He envisions a new economic architecture built on regional solidarity and practical cooperation, enabling seamless interaction and collaboration among African businesses. This collaborative framework is crucial for sharing best practices, fostering innovation, and maximizing the impact of development initiatives. The partnership with Mombasa County serves as a model for this approach, showcasing the potential of public-private partnerships to drive sustainable development. The Jospong Group’s experience in other African countries, where they have successfully implemented scalable waste management systems, creating jobs and promoting a circular economy, reinforces their commitment to this collaborative vision.

Governor Nassir has expressed enthusiastic support for the collaboration, recognizing the Jospong Group’s proven track record across the continent. He prioritizes practical solutions that deliver immediate, tangible results while simultaneously building a foundation for long-term environmental resilience. This partnership signifies a shared vision for a cleaner, healthier, and more prosperous Mombasa, leveraging innovative waste management strategies to achieve both economic and environmental goals. The Jospong Group’s expansion into Kenya represents a significant stride towards realizing its vision of a self-reliant Africa, driven by innovation, collaboration, and sustainable development, transforming sanitation challenges into opportunities for growth and prosperity.
